Joe Gerth reports that the biggest news of the day is that Bruce Lunsford still hasn’t filed to run for the U.S. Senate.
The biggest story of the filing deadline so far isn’t who has filed to run for office. It’s who hasn’t.
Bruce Lunsford, who is being courted by Democrats in Washington to take on Sen. Mitch McConnell, hasn’t yet made an appearance at the Capitol. Achim Bergmann, his former campaign manager, said this morning that he was still waiting for Lunsford to tell him his plans.
